Connor O’Toole is a promising tennis player and a recent law school graduate who gets pulled into a closed coastal world of wealthy people—and quickly becomes accustomed to its pleasures. He gets drawn into a hidden romance with a woman much older than himself, while at the same time growing close to a young, fragile heiress of a vast fortune. But behind the tranquil ocean paradise lurk dangerous currents and traps capable of ruining his plans and stripping him of a chance to break into the “upper league” of life. Whiting Award winner Teddy Wayne has written a dark, fast-moving thriller—shocking and cinematic psychological fiction that exposes the morals of the modern elite ruthlessly and precisely.
